Horror! Maurauders kill 66-year old widow, four children in Jos
| Print | E-mail
Written by Isaac Shobayo
Monday, 07 March 2011

The Nigerian Tribune learnt that the attackers, numbering about twenty were said to have sneaked into the village at about 1:05 am when all the inhabitants had gone to bed, they gained access to the village through the hills in the neighbourhood.

It was learnt that on entering the village, they proceeded to Daguit family compound at the extreme end of the village close to the railway line and released several volley of gunshots into the air to probably scare the residents or to announce their arrival.

An eye witness account told the Nigerian Tribune that the assailants who were all in black attire to hide their identities shot at random within the Daguit compound and succeeded in killing a 66 years old widow and her four grown up children residing within the compound.

The eldest son of the widow who survived the incident by the whiskers, Ezekiel Daguit, told the Nigerian Tribune that the assailants were not robbers but assassins who came with the intention of wiping out the entire family. He said at about I: 05 am on Monday, his dogs were barking and he decided to peep through the window before coming out to see what was happening.

Ezekiel said before he could put his act together, the people had forced their ways into his mother’s room and pumped bullets into her. They were not done yet as they dragged the aged woman out of her room to confirm that she was dead. After that he said they moved to his sister, and also snuffed life out of her.
